On Mon, Sep 09, 2019 at 04:50:15PM +0200, Daniel Lezcano wrote: > Currently the idle injection framework only allows to inject the > deepest idle state available on the system. > > Give the opportunity to specify which idle state we want to inject by > adding a new function helper to set the state and use it when calling > play_idle(). > > There is no functional changes, the cpuidle state is the deepest one. > > Signed-off-by: Daniel Lezcano <daniel.lezcano@linaro.org> > --- > drivers/powercap/idle_inject.c | 15 ++++++++++++++- > include/linux/idle_inject.h | 3 +++ > 2 files changed, 17 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-) > > diff --git a/drivers/powercap/idle_inject.c b/drivers/powercap/idle_inject.c > index 9b18667b9f26..a612c425d74c 100644 > --- a/drivers/powercap/idle_inject.c > +++ b/drivers/powercap/idle_inject.c > @@ -38,6 +38,7 @@ > #define pr_fmt(fmt) "ii_dev: " fmt > > #include <linux/cpu.h> > +#include <linux/cpuidle.h> > #include <linux/hrtimer.h> > #include <linux/kthread.h> > #include <linux/sched.h> > @@ -65,6 +66,7 @@ struct idle_inject_thread { > */ > struct idle_inject_device { > struct hrtimer timer; > + int state; > unsigned int idle_duration_us; > unsigned int run_duration_us; > unsigned long int cpumask[0]; > @@ -139,7 +141,7 @@ static void idle_inject_fn(unsigned int cpu) > iit->should_run = 0; > > play_idle(READ_ONCE(ii_dev->idle_duration_us), > - cpuidle_find_deepest_state()); > + READ_ONCE(ii_dev->state)); > } > > /** > @@ -170,6 +172,16 @@ void idle_inject_get_duration(struct idle_inject_device *ii_dev, > *idle_duration_us = READ_ONCE(ii_dev->idle_duration_us); > } > > +/** > + * idle_inject_set_state - set the idle state to inject > + * @state: an integer for the idle state to inject > + */ > +void idle_inject_set_state(struct idle_inject_device *ii_dev, int state) > +{ > + if (state >= CPUIDLE_STATE_NOUSE && state < CPUIDLE_STATE_MAX) > + WRITE_ONCE(ii_dev->state, state); > +} > + > /** > * idle_inject_start - start idle injections > * @ii_dev: idle injection control device structure > @@ -298,6 +310,7 @@ struct idle_inject_device *idle_inject_register(struct cpumask *cpumask) > cpumask_copy(to_cpumask(ii_dev->cpumask), cpumask); > hrtimer_init(&ii_dev->timer, CLOCK_MONOTONIC, HRTIMER_MODE_REL); > ii_dev->timer.function = idle_inject_timer_fn; > + ii_dev->state = cpuidle_find_deepest_state(); > > for_each_cpu(cpu, to_cpumask(ii_dev->cpumask)) { > > diff --git a/include/linux/idle_inject.h b/include/linux/idle_inject.h > index a445cd1a36c5..e2b26b9ccd34 100644 > --- a/include/linux/idle_inject.h > +++ b/include/linux/idle_inject.h > @@ -26,4 +26,7 @@ void idle_inject_set_duration(struct idle_inject_device *ii_dev, > void idle_inject_get_duration(struct idle_inject_device *ii_dev, > unsigned int *run_duration_us, > unsigned int *idle_duration_us); > + > +void idle_inject_set_state(struct idle_inject_device *ii_dev, int state); > +
The above function is not used in this patch and as such should be introduce as part of future work. Otherwise I agree that this patch does not carry any functional changes.
Without function idle_inject_set_state():
